WitrynaState entrepreneur programs for immigrants. State governments may sponsor immigrant entrepreneur programs that offer services and funding opportunities. Nearly all states offer some type of general entrepreneurship programs. Many establish regional offices where small business owners can go to receive various types of support. Witryna20 sie 2024 · Are immigrants eligible for state benefit programs? In some states, yes. Twenty-six states make immigrants eligible for state-funded benefit programs. … Witryna12 kwi 2024 · In 2024, immigrants contributed $48.3 billion in tax dollars to Medicare. Despite their contributions, immigrants are underrepresented as users of Medicare and Medicaid. Only 11.9% of users of these programs were foreign-born in 2024 despite the fact that immigrants are 13.6% of the overall population.
